Kevin Szafraniec looks at the 12 biggest risers in redraft ADP since the beginning of the preseason and breaks down whether fantasy managers should be buying or selling them at their current prices.
As the preseason heats up every year, we see training camp buzz lead to ADP explosions across fantasy football. While there are generally legitimate reasons for the buzz, sometimes the hype goes overboard, turning what was once a strong target into a clear avoid. As we come down the stretch of the 2025 offseason, we definitely find ourselves in the thick of the preseason hype period.
In order to decide whether fantasy managers should continue to buy 2025’s biggest risers at their elevated ADPs, we will be taking a look at why they have seen an increase in price and if they can still deliver value at their current ADP. For this exercise, I’ll be pulling ADP information from the FFPC’s Main Event and Big Gorilla going back to the last week of July.
